Why Regular Eye Exams Matter
Many individuals postponed checking out the eye doctor up until something goes wrong-- blurry vision, eye pressure, or pain. Nevertheless, routine exams have to do with far more than just updating your prescription.
Early Detection of Diseases-- Conditions like glaucoma, cataracts, and macular degeneration usually create without evident signs. An eye doctor can spot these issues early prior to they trigger irreversible damages.
Children's Vision Health-- Kids rely greatly on their vision for knowing. Regular check-ups with an eye doctor in College Station can help make certain that vision issues don't disrupt school efficiency.
General Health Clues-- Did you know that an eye doctor near me can often be the first to identify conditions like diabetes or hypertension? The eyes frequently reveal warning signs prior to the rest of the body does.

Eye Health Tips Between Visits
While seeing an eye doctor near me on a regular basis is important, there are steps you can take in your home to keep your vision sharp:
Take Screen Breaks: Follow the 20-20-20 policy-- every 20 mins, look at something 20 feet away for at the very least 20 secs.
Eat for Eye Health: Foods rich in vitamin A, omega-3s, and anti-oxidants (like carrots, spinach, and fish) assistance strong vision.
Protect from UV: Sunglasses that block UVA and UVB rays safeguard your eyes from sun damages.
Keep Hydrated: Drinking water stops completely dry eyes and irritation.
When to Visit an Eye Doctor Immediately
Even if you see your optometrist College Station frequently, particular symptoms shouldn't be overlooked:
Abrupt vision adjustments (blurriness, double vision, or loss of view).
Frequent headaches associated with eye strain.
Discomfort, soreness, or swelling that doesn't go away.
Problem seeing during the night or level of sensitivity to light.
